- This position offers you a unique opportunity to obtain your masters degree while gaining insight into cutting-edge MEMS technology.
- You will contribute to magnetic characterizations and micromagnetic simulations to perform systematic studies of how geometry material composition and crystallographic influence an micro-actuator performance.
- You will present and discuss your results with your team as well with the academic collaborator.
- The findings of your study will contribute to optimization strategies for the next generation of MEMS-based cell sorting devices used in cancer research.
- Your workplace is Bergisch Gladbach.
- The project is a collaboration with the research institute Forschungszentrum Jülich.
